How to do Climbing

  1. Choose a climbing wall, crag, or bouldering route suited to your ability, and put on appropriate footwear and safety equipment.
  2. Start with your hands on solid holds and your feet placed carefully on footholds, keeping your hips close to the wall.
  3. Move upward by driving through your legs and using your arms mainly for balance, shifting your weight deliberately from hold to hold.
  4. Climb for the desired duration or number of routes, resting between attempts as needed.
